Webflow Conditional Visibility

Write hundreds of SEO optimized articles in minutes.

Programmatic SEO writer for brands and niche site owners

Webflow's conditional visibility feature transforms static websites into dynamic, responsive experiences that adapt to user behavior and device types. This powerful tool allows designers to control when and where specific elements appear, creating personalized journeys for every visitor. Whether you're hiding navigation elements on mobile devices or displaying targeted content based on user interactions, conditional visibility opens up endless possibilities for creating engaging web experiences.

What Makes Conditional Visibility Essential for Modern Websites

Modern web users expect personalized experiences that adapt to their specific needs and devices. Conditional visibility in Webflow addresses this expectation by allowing designers to create sophisticated rules that control element visibility based on various conditions. This feature eliminates the need for multiple page versions while maintaining a clean, organized design system that works seamlessly across all platforms.

The beauty of conditional visibility lies in its ability to reduce cognitive load for users while maximizing the effectiveness of your content. Rather than overwhelming visitors with irrelevant information, you can strategically show only what matters most to them at any given moment. This targeted approach not only improves user experience but also increases conversion rates by presenting the right message at the right time.

Device-Specific Content Strategy

Creating device-specific experiences has become crucial as mobile traffic continues to dominate web usage. Webflow's conditional visibility allows you to tailor content presentation for desktop, tablet, and mobile users without compromising design integrity. You can display detailed product descriptions on desktop while showing condensed versions on mobile, ensuring optimal readability across all screen sizes.

Smart device targeting goes beyond simple hide-and-show functionality. You can create entirely different user flows for different devices, such as displaying a full navigation menu on desktop while showing a hamburger menu on mobile. This approach maintains consistency in your brand experience while optimizing usability for each platform's unique interaction patterns.

Screen Size Optimization Techniques

Screen size conditions provide granular control over how your content adapts to different viewport dimensions. Unlike basic responsive design that relies solely on CSS breakpoints, conditional visibility allows you to make strategic content decisions based on available screen real estate. You can hide secondary elements on smaller screens while emphasizing primary calls-to-action for better conversion rates.

Advanced screen size targeting enables you to create truly adaptive layouts that respond to specific pixel ranges. For example, you might display a three-column layout for screens wider than 1200 pixels, switch to two columns for medium screens, and stack elements vertically for smaller viewports. This level of control ensures your content always looks intentional and professionally designed.

How to Set Up Basic Conditional Visibility Rules

Setting up conditional visibility in Webflow begins with selecting the element you want to control and accessing the visibility settings in the right sidebar. The interface provides intuitive options for defining when elements should appear or disappear based on your chosen conditions. Start with simple device-based rules before progressing to more complex interaction-based conditions.

The key to successful implementation lies in understanding your content hierarchy and user priorities. Begin by identifying which elements are essential for all users versus those that enhance the experience for specific segments. This strategic approach ensures you're not just hiding content randomly but making deliberate decisions that improve overall user experience.

Essential setup considerations include testing your visibility rules across different devices and screen sizes to ensure they work as intended. Use Webflow's preview functionality to verify that elements appear and disappear correctly, and pay attention to how the layout adjusts when elements are hidden. Proper testing prevents layout issues and ensures a smooth user experience across all conditions.

Device Type Configuration

Device type configuration forms the foundation of most conditional visibility strategies. Webflow allows you to specify whether elements should appear on desktop, tablet, or mobile devices, giving you complete control over the user experience on each platform. This feature is particularly valuable for optimizing navigation elements, hero sections, and content blocks that need different treatments across devices.

When configuring device-specific visibility, consider the unique interaction patterns and limitations of each platform. Mobile users typically prefer simplified interfaces with larger touch targets, while desktop users can handle more complex layouts with detailed information. Tablet users often fall somewhere in between, requiring a balanced approach that works well with both touch and cursor interactions.

Screen Width Parameters

Screen width parameters offer more precise control than basic device categories, allowing you to create breakpoints that align perfectly with your design needs. You can set minimum and maximum width values to target specific screen size ranges, ensuring your content looks optimal regardless of the exact device being used. This approach is particularly useful for handling the wide variety of screen sizes in today's device landscape.

Advanced width targeting enables you to create sophisticated responsive behaviors that go beyond traditional CSS media queries. For instance, you might hide sidebar content for screens between 768 and 1024 pixels wide while keeping it visible for both smaller and larger screens. This level of granular control helps you optimize the user experience for every possible viewing scenario.

Advanced Interaction-Based Visibility Controls

Interaction-based visibility controls elevate your website from static to dynamic by responding to user behavior in real-time[1]. These advanced features allow you to create engaging experiences that reveal content based on hover states, clicks, scrolling behavior, and other user actions. The result is a more interactive and personalized experience that keeps visitors engaged longer.

Building effective interaction-based rules requires understanding user behavior patterns and anticipating what information users need at different stages of their journey. Consider how users typically navigate your site and identify opportunities to provide helpful information or calls-to-action at the right moments. This strategic approach ensures your interactive elements enhance rather than distract from the user experience.

Successful interaction design balances functionality with performance, ensuring that dynamic elements don't slow down your site or create confusing user experiences. Test all interactive visibility rules thoroughly across different devices and browsers to ensure consistent behavior. Pay special attention to touch interactions on mobile devices, as hover states don't translate directly to touch interfaces.

Hover State Implementations

Hover state implementations create subtle yet effective ways to reveal additional information without cluttering your initial design. You can use hover triggers to display tooltips, expand product details, or show navigation submenus that appear only when users express interest by hovering over specific elements. This approach keeps your interface clean while providing access to detailed information when needed.

Strategic hover implementations should feel natural and intuitive to users, appearing quickly enough to be responsive but not so fast that they trigger accidentally. Consider the timing and animation of your hover effects to create smooth transitions that enhance rather than distract from the user experience. Remember that hover states don't exist on touch devices, so always provide alternative access methods for mobile users.

Click-Triggered Content Reveals

Click-triggered content reveals provide powerful ways to create progressive disclosure experiences that guide users through complex information. You can use click events to expand FAQ sections, reveal detailed product specifications, or show additional form fields based on user selections. This approach reduces cognitive load by presenting information in digestible chunks.

Effective click-triggered reveals should provide clear visual feedback to users, indicating what will happen when they interact with trigger elements. Use consistent styling for clickable elements and ensure that revealed content appears in logical locations that don't disrupt the overall page flow. Consider adding subtle animations to make the content reveals feel smooth and professional.

Performance Optimization for Conditional Visibility

Performance optimization becomes crucial when implementing extensive conditional visibility rules throughout your website. While Webflow is optimized for performance, having too many visibility conditions can potentially impact page load times and user experience. Regular review and optimization of your visibility settings ensures your site maintains fast loading speeds while delivering dynamic content.

Smart optimization strategies focus on reducing the complexity of visibility rules while maintaining their effectiveness. Group related elements together and apply visibility settings to entire sections rather than individual elements when possible. This approach reduces the number of conditions the browser needs to evaluate while loading your page.

Monitoring tools and analytics help you understand how your conditional visibility rules affect user behavior and site performance. Track metrics like page load times, bounce rates, and user engagement to identify opportunities for improvement. Use this data to refine your visibility strategies and ensure they're contributing positively to your overall user experience.

Code Efficiency Best Practices

Code efficiency best practices ensure your conditional visibility rules don't negatively impact site performance:

  1. Minimize the number of individual visibility conditions by grouping related elements and applying rules to parent containers whenever possible.
  2. Use consistent naming conventions for elements with visibility rules to make future updates and maintenance more manageable.
  3. Regularly audit your visibility settings to remove unnecessary or redundant conditions that may have accumulated over time.
  4. Test performance across different devices to ensure your visibility rules don't create performance bottlenecks on slower devices or connections.
  5. Consider the cumulative impact of multiple visibility conditions on the same page and optimize accordingly.

Loading Speed Considerations

Loading speed considerations become particularly important when conditional visibility affects above-the-fold content. Elements that are hidden on initial page load still consume resources during the loading process, so strategic planning of your visibility rules can improve perceived performance. Consider using progressive enhancement techniques that load essential content first and add conditional elements afterward.

Browser rendering optimization involves understanding how conditional visibility affects the critical rendering path. Elements that are conditionally hidden may still trigger resource downloads, such as images or embedded content, even when they're not visible to users. Use lazy loading techniques and optimize your visibility rules to prevent unnecessary resource consumption.

Content Strategy Integration Techniques

Content strategy integration ensures your conditional visibility rules align with your overall content goals and user journey mapping. Rather than treating visibility as a purely technical feature, consider how it can enhance your content strategy by delivering the right message to the right audience at the right time. This strategic approach maximizes the impact of both your content and your visibility rules.

Effective integration requires understanding your audience segments and their unique needs throughout the customer journey. Map out different user paths through your site and identify opportunities where conditional visibility can improve the experience for specific segments. This might include showing different calls-to-action for new versus returning visitors or displaying industry-specific content based on user behavior.

Content personalization through conditional visibility creates more engaging experiences that feel tailored to individual users. You can create dynamic content blocks that adapt based on user interactions, previous page visits, or other behavioral indicators. This approach increases relevance and engagement while maintaining a single, manageable website structure.

Audience Segmentation Applications

Audience segmentation applications leverage conditional visibility to create personalized experiences for different user groups. You can display different messaging for first-time visitors versus returning customers, show location-specific content based on geographic data, or present role-specific information for different types of users. This targeted approach increases relevance and improves conversion rates.

Behavioral segmentation takes personalization further by adapting content based on user actions and engagement patterns. You might show additional product recommendations to users who have viewed multiple items, display simplified navigation for users who seem to be struggling, or present special offers to users who have spent significant time on pricing pages. These dynamic responses create more engaging and effective user experiences.

Content Hierarchy Optimization

Content hierarchy optimization uses conditional visibility to guide users through information in logical, digestible sequences. You can create progressive disclosure experiences that reveal additional details as users express interest, helping them find relevant information without feeling overwhelmed. This approach is particularly effective for complex products or services that require detailed explanation.

Strategic hierarchy implementation considers both user needs and business goals when determining what content to show when. Primary calls-to-action should remain visible across all conditions, while supporting information can be revealed contextually. This balance ensures users can always take desired actions while having access to the information they need to make informed decisions.

Mobile-First Visibility Strategies

Mobile-first visibility strategies recognize that mobile users often have different needs and constraints compared to desktop users. Touch interfaces, smaller screens, and often slower connections require thoughtful approaches to conditional visibility that prioritize essential content and streamline interactions. Start by designing your visibility rules for mobile users, then enhance the experience for larger screens.

Effective mobile strategies focus on reducing cognitive load and minimizing the number of interactions required to complete tasks. Hide secondary navigation elements that might clutter the interface, simplify form layouts by showing only essential fields initially, and use conditional visibility to create step-by-step processes that feel manageable on small screens.

Performance considerations become even more critical on mobile devices, where users may have slower connections and less processing power. Optimize your conditional visibility rules to minimize the impact on loading times and ensure that essential content appears quickly. Consider using progressive enhancement techniques that load core content first and add conditional elements as resources allow.

Touch Interface Adaptations

Touch interface adaptations require rethinking how users interact with conditional visibility triggers. Hover states don't exist on touch devices, so click or tap interactions become the primary method for revealing hidden content. Design your trigger elements to be large enough for easy tapping and provide clear visual feedback when users interact with them.

Gesture-based interactions can enhance mobile conditional visibility experiences when implemented thoughtfully. Swipe gestures can reveal additional content panels, pinch-to-zoom can show detailed information, and long-press interactions can access secondary options. However, these gestures should supplement rather than replace standard tap interactions to ensure accessibility for all users.

Screen Real Estate Management

Screen real estate management on mobile devices requires strategic decisions about what content to prioritize. Use conditional visibility to hide less critical elements and focus attention on primary actions and essential information. This might mean hiding detailed product descriptions initially while keeping key features and pricing visible, allowing users to access full details through tap interactions.

Vertical space optimization becomes crucial on mobile devices where users scroll vertically through content. Use conditional visibility to create collapsible sections that allow users to focus on relevant information while keeping other sections easily accessible. This approach maintains comprehensive content coverage while preventing overwhelming single-page experiences.

Cross-Platform Consistency Guidelines

Cross-platform consistency guidelines ensure your conditional visibility rules create cohesive experiences across all devices while optimizing for each platform's unique characteristics. Users should feel like they're interacting with the same brand and content regardless of their device, even when the presentation adapts to different screen sizes and interaction methods.

Brand consistency extends beyond visual elements to include functional consistency in how conditional visibility behaves across platforms. While the specific implementation might differ between desktop and mobile, the underlying logic and user outcomes should remain consistent. Users should be able to accomplish the same tasks and access the same information regardless of their chosen device.

Testing consistency requires systematic evaluation of your conditional visibility rules across multiple devices and browsers. Create testing protocols that verify not just that elements appear and disappear correctly, but that the overall user experience remains coherent and goal-oriented across all platforms. Pay special attention to transition points between different visibility states to ensure smooth user experiences.

Brand Experience Alignment

Brand experience alignment ensures that conditional visibility enhances rather than disrupts your brand identity. The way elements appear and disappear should feel consistent with your brand's personality and communication style. Smooth, professional transitions reinforce premium brand positioning, while playful animations might better suit more casual brands.

Visual consistency across conditional states maintains brand recognition even as content adapts to different contexts. Use consistent color schemes, typography, and spacing in both visible and conditionally revealed content. This approach ensures that users always feel connected to your brand, regardless of which elements are currently visible on their screen.

User Experience Continuity

User experience continuity focuses on maintaining logical flow and navigation patterns across different visibility states. Users should never feel lost or confused when elements appear or disappear based on conditional rules. Clear visual hierarchy and consistent interaction patterns help users understand how to navigate your site regardless of which elements are currently visible.

Transition management plays a crucial role in maintaining continuity as users move between different devices or screen orientations. When a user switches from portrait to landscape mode on a tablet, or moves from mobile to desktop, the conditional visibility changes should feel natural and predictable. Smooth transitions and logical content reorganization help maintain user engagement throughout these changes.

Troubleshooting Common Implementation Issues

Troubleshooting common implementation issues helps you identify and resolve problems before they impact user experience. Most conditional visibility problems stem from conflicting rules, improper element hierarchy, or misunderstanding how different conditions interact with each other. Systematic debugging approaches help you isolate and fix these issues efficiently.

Documentation and organization become crucial as your conditional visibility rules grow more complex. Keep detailed records of which elements have visibility conditions applied and what those conditions are designed to accomplish. This documentation helps you troubleshoot issues more quickly and prevents conflicts when multiple team members work on the same project.

Testing protocols should include edge cases and unusual scenarios that might reveal hidden problems with your conditional visibility implementation. Test what happens when users resize their browser windows, switch between different devices mid-session, or interact with elements in unexpected sequences. These edge case tests often reveal issues that don't appear during normal usage patterns.

Common Configuration Mistakes

Common configuration mistakes often involve misunderstanding how multiple conditions interact with each other:

  • Conflicting visibility rules that create situations where elements should both appear and be hidden simultaneously
  • Incorrect element targeting that applies visibility conditions to parent elements when child elements were intended
  • Missing fallback conditions that leave elements permanently hidden when primary conditions aren't met
  • Overly complex rule combinations that create unpredictable behavior across different scenarios
  • Inadequate testing across device types leading to broken experiences on specific platforms

Performance Debugging Methods

Performance debugging methods help identify when conditional visibility rules are impacting site speed or user experience. Use browser developer tools to monitor how visibility conditions affect page rendering and resource loading. Look for situations where hidden elements are still consuming bandwidth or processing power unnecessarily.

Systematic performance testing involves measuring page load times and user interaction responsiveness with and without conditional visibility rules active. This comparison helps you understand the true performance impact of your implementation and identify opportunities for optimization. Focus particularly on above-the-fold content and primary user interaction points.

Transform Your Website with Smart Conditional Visibility

Conditional visibility in Webflow represents a fundamental shift from static web design to dynamic, user-centered experiences that adapt intelligently to individual needs and contexts. By implementing these strategies thoughtfully, you create websites that feel personal and responsive while maintaining clean, manageable code structures. The key lies in balancing functionality with performance, ensuring that your dynamic elements enhance rather than complicate the user experience.

Success with conditional visibility requires ongoing optimization and refinement based on user behavior and performance data. Start with simple implementations and gradually build complexity as you understand how your audience interacts with dynamic content. Remember that the most effective conditional visibility rules are often invisible to users—they simply make the experience feel more intuitive and personalized.

Ready to transform your static website into a dynamic, engaging experience? Start implementing conditional visibility in your Webflow projects today and discover how this powerful feature can improve user engagement, increase conversions, and set your website apart from the competition.